你查询的IP:[117.80.190.89]  地理位置:中国–江苏–苏州电信

最新查询123.4.246.233 124.160.30.217 123.178.213.130 219.216.142.154 123.244.163.35 119.10.182.148 116.196.199.248 122.51.136.58 123.177.219.184 117.80.190.89 116.66.73.41 121.204.0.46 119.27.64.222 121.52.208.145 220.242.9.217 119.144.225.150 117.24.237.117 203.100.192.189 124.40.128.53 202.127.160.68 58.68.128.233 121.32.181.132 123.138.89.199 119.112.26.88 159.226.120.141 169.211.1.183 210.56.192.89 61.4.80.17 202.91.128.95 116.90.184.24 202.95.252.78